2 UNDERGRADUATE INTERNSHIP OPPORTUNITIES FOR STUDENTS 1) The 2014 University of Maryland School of Public Health Summer Training and Research (STAR) Program is designed to provide traditionally under-represented undergraduate students with 2 consecutive summers of a 10-week research training and career development program to enhance their potential to apply for and complete graduate degrees in biomedical and behavioral science relevant to preventing and treating cardiovascular disease. 2) UM ADAPT: The Aging Diversity And Professional Training (UM ADAPT) Program provides underrepresented undergraduates with 2 yrs of research, ethics, and career development training. The overall aim is to increase diversity in individuals who choose careers in biomedical/behavioral research related to aging. The application form and required documents are attached. Applications are due March 21st More information is available at sph.umd.edu/KNES/STAR/index.html
